Eye swelling can last anywhere from a few hours to several days, depending on the cause. Allergies, insect bites, or minor injuries may lead to temporary swelling that subsides quickly, while conditions like infections or more severe injuries may require medical attention and take longer to heal. If swelling persists or is accompanied by pain, vision changes, or discharge, it's important to consult a healthcare professional.
Copyright © 2026 eLLeNow.com All Rights Reserved.